All eyes on Grandmaster Johan-Sebastian Christiansen of Norway when the much waited Manny Pacquiao International Open dubbed as 87th Kàlilangan Chess Festival 2026 gets underway on February 23 to 27, 2026 at the Family Country Hotel, General Santos City.
Organized by the Pacman Chess Association, the five-day Standard (90 minutes plus 30 seconds increment time control format) backed up by former Senator Many Pacquiao, offers 20,000 US dollars to the champion.
With an Elo rating of 2659, Christiansen is the top seed in the tournament.
Christiansen was awarded the titles International Master, in 2015, and Grandmaster, in 2018, by FIDE.
In 2022, Christiansen won the 1st Colonia de Santa Jordi Chess Festival on a tie- break with Brandon Clarke, with a score of 7.5/9.
Among the early entries are
GM Pa Iniyan of India, GM Arkadij Naiditsch of Bulgaria, GM N R Visakh of India, GM Li Men Peng of Switzerland, GM Vitaly Sivuk of Sweden, GM Platon Galperin of Sweden, GM Susanto Megaranto of Indonesia, GM VS Raahul of India, GM Novendra Priasmoro of Indonesia, GM Nguyen Doc Hoa of Vietnam , GM John Paul Gomez, IM Christian Gian Karlo Tade-Arca , IM Kim Stevan Yap, Lennon Hart Salgados, Andrei Ainsley Dolorosa, Diego Abraham Caparino, Lightus De Leon, Edmundo Lao and Emmanuel Pacquiao Sr. of the Philippines.
Also joining in the event organized by Pacman Chess Association are IM Haochen Jiang of China, IM Arif Abdul Hafiz of Indonesia, IM Jodi Azarya Setyaki of Indonesia, IM Bala Chandra Prasad Dhulipalla of India, WIM Hagawane Aakansha of India , WIM Furtado Ivana Maria of India and WFM Yilin Li of Canada.
The Tournament Director is Orly Ortega while Chief Arbiter IA James Infiesto is assisted by Deputy Chief Arbiter IA Michael Joseph Pagaran and FA Margie Narcilla.-Marlon Bernardino-
